Exploring the Relationship Between Generative Artificial Intelligence Usage and the Development of University Students’ Critical Thinking in Higher Education

The increasingly widespread use of generative artificial intelligence (GenAI) in higher education has raised concerns about its influence on the development of students' critical thinking. This study aims to analyze the relationship between the intensity of GenAI use and changes in students' critical thinking skills. The study used a quantitative approach with a longitudinal correlational design on 186 students from three universities. Data was collected through GenAI usage questionnaires and critical thinking tests at the beginning and end of the semester. The analysis was performed using descriptive statistics, paired t-tests, Pearson correlation, and linear regression. The results showed an increase in critical thinking scores from 68.4 to 74.9, as well as a moderate positive relationship between the use of reflective GenAI and critical thinking development (r=0.46; p<0.001). The findings confirm the importance of the integration of directed, reflective, and evaluation-based GenAI in learning to improve the quality of higher education
